In recent decades, authors affiliated with P.A. Hertzen Moscow Oncology Research Institute have published 890 papers, which have received a total of 9.1k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 332 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 215 papers in Oncology and 190 papers in Surgery on the topics of Photodynamic Therapy Research Studies (78 papers),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(75 papers) and Renal cell carcinoma treatment (62 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(3.7k citations), Molecular Biology (2.7k citations) and Oncology (2.1k citations). Authors at P.A. Hertzen Moscow Oncology Research Institute collaborate with scholars in Russia, United States and France and have published in prestigious journals including The Lancet, Journal of Clinical Oncology and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ología. Some of P.A. Hertzen Moscow Oncology Research Institute's most productive authors include B. Yа. Alekseev, Alexander Tonevitsky, Andrey Turchinovich, Е. В. Филоненко, M. Yu. Shkurnikov, Timur R. Samatov, Victor Sokolov, А. Д. Каприн, J. A. Makarova and Arnulf Stenzl.
